Jakob L. Kreuze writes:
> * gnu/machine/ssh.scm (managed-host-remote-eval): Pass an appropriate
> 'become-command' to 'remote-eval'.
> * guix/ssh.scm (remote-authorize-signing-key): Add optional
> 'become-command' argument.
> All callers changed.
> ---
> gnu/machine/ssh.scm | 7 +++++--
> guix/ssh.scm | 5 +++--
> 2 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
